Kundli Matching
Kundli Matching, also called Ashtakoot Guna Milan, is the traditional Hindu compatibility check before marriage. It compares the Moon signs, nakshatras and planetary positions of two people across eight kootas to produce a score out of 36.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is a good Ashtakoot score?
A score of 18 or above is traditionally considered acceptable. 24-30 is very good and 31-36 is excellent.
Does a low score mean we should not marry?
No. Ashtakoot is one of many factors. Family, health, values and mutual respect also matter.
